Key Responsibilities
- Support the Operations Manager in daily production activities, including thermal treatment, chemical leaching, milling, blending, and related processes.
- Coordinate workflows across production, engineering, logistics, and chemical leaching teams to maintain smooth operations.
- Track production output, recovery yields, and process efficiency to meet operational targets.
- Ensure materials are handled, processed, and stored according to approved SOPs and work instructions.
- Assist in troubleshooting process deviations, upsets, and operational issues to restore stable performance.
- Enforce safe handling procedures for hazardous chemicals and high-value materials, ensuring disciplined compliance on site.
- Ensure adherence to workplace safety, health, and environmental (SHE) regulations and company standards.
- Participate in incident investigations and root cause analysis, and support corrective/ preventive action implementation.
- Promote safety culture through toolbox talks, inspections, and routine safety briefings.
- Maintain full traceability and accurate documentation for materials, including verification of sampling, testing, weighing, and inspection activities.
- Support internal, external, and customer audits, ensuring compliance with policies, customer requirements, and regulatory obligations.
- Lead and supervise production teams, supporting manpower planning, shift scheduling, task allocation, coaching, and acting as Operations Manager’s delegate when needed.
- Monitor inventory levels of critical spares, work-in-progress, and finished jobs.
- Review and update SOPs and work instructions as required.
